Wi-Fi connectivity
Many smart vacuum cleaners function well without Wi-Fi. However connecting your robot to internet access unlocks advanced features that increase the efficiency and comfort. Some of these features include precise home mapping and customizing cleaning preferences, as well as remote control via an app on your mobile. Some allow you to give your robot a fun name. The app can also send regular updates to the vacuum cleaner's firmware.
Connecting a robot vacuum WiFi is simple, however it is essential to follow the manufacturer's directions and also check the settings of your router. Most newer vacuum cleaners use 2.4GHz wireless signals, which have more coverage and are more stable than 5GHz connections. However, some dual-band routers can transmit both 2.4GHz and 5GHz signals. If you have a dual-band wireless router, be sure to select 2.4GHz on your phone when you set it up.
The application for your robot is typically simple to use and allows you to start, stop and schedule cleaning sessions. Some models also integrate with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ant which allows you to make use of voice commands to start the robot. This feature is especially beneficial for pets and busy families as it frees your hands and lets you concentrate on other tasks while the vacuum does its work.
You can also customize the app by setting up no-go zones or adjusting cleaning modes. Some apps even generate heat maps to help you understand your home's dirtiest areas and adjust the suction level of your robot accordingly. You can also alter the cleaning preferences or schedules for each room. Certain models allow you to pause and resume the cleaning session.
A strong connection to the internet is important for your robot vacuum's navigation system, so be certain to ensure that it has a good signal from Wi-Fi and doesn't have any connectivity issues. If your vacuum is having problems connecting to the internet Try moving it closer to the router, or using an extension for Wi-Fi to boost the strength of your signal. If the problem persists, it may be the time to reach out to the customer support department of your router.
Navigation system
The navigation system of a robotic vacuum plays a crucial role in its ability to avoid obstacles and thoroughly clean. There are many different types of navigation systems, ranging from simple bump sensors to sophisticated mapping technology. A good navigation system can make your robot cleaner more efficient.
The majority of basic robot vacuums employ a combination of sensors and algorithms to navigate. They use bump sensors to detect solids and infrared sensors to identify hot or cold objects. This allows robots to avoid furniture, as well as other heavy objects that are large and bulky. These sensors also help the robot to track its position in space, which is essential for precise navigation.
Cameras are used by more advanced robot vacuums to improve navigation accuracy. Cameras use sensors and lens to capture images, which are then analyzed for their location. The robot also uses the information from the images to find obstacles and draw a map to map out its route. Additionally the camera is able to recognize things like doors and windows and avoid them.
The most advanced robotic vacuums use LIDAR technology to scan the room and create 3D maps. This technology is similar to the system used by self-driving vehicles. Contrary to other sensors, LIDAR is less affected by changes in lighting conditions. This makes it suitable for use in rooms that have a wide range of lighting conditions.
ECOVACS DEEBOTs use this cutting-edge technology in their latest models. Their mapping capabilities, combined with dToF laser navigation give an even more precise map of the home than traditional sensors. The robot can detect obstacles in real-time and design the best cleaning route automatically. It also reduces manual intervention and ensures thorough cleaning.
While a robot using basic navigation system can eventually clean your home, it could take a long time and miss some areas. A navigation system that is more sophisticated will be less prone to errors and will be more efficient. A robotic vacuum equipped with an integrated mapping system will not only be able to spot obstacles, but will also record its movements and keep the details of its cleaning. This allows the robot to return to an exact area without having to retrace its journey.
Battery life
The battery life of a robot vacuum cleaner's longevity is crucial to its performance. The battery life of a robot vacuum cleaner depends on the frequency with which it is used, the long it is running and charging and what kind of debris it gathers. A high-quality robot will return to its dock and charge when needed. Cleaning the brushes regularly and taking hairs off of the suction system will prolong the battery life of your robot. Keeping the device clean can also lower the energy usage.
Most robots use lithium-ion batteries, which offer a high power density and a long cycle lives. However, older models utilized nickel-metal hydride batteries, which have shorter battery lifespans and require longer recharge times. Switch to a Lithium-ion type battery in the event that your robot has an nickel-metal-hydride model to improve performance.
Consider storing your robot in a dry and cool area, and clean the area of liquid dangers, such as spills or water bottles that have been opened. The effects of liquids can harm electronic components which can reduce battery performance and possibly leading to premature failure.
A well-maintained robotic system could last up to four years, based on the model and brand. Regular maintenance involves cleaning the wheels of debris and looking for floor vacuum robot sharp objects and blockages and regularly cleaning mop heads. You should also clean the vacuum's waste bin and empty it every time you use it. You should also check the battery for signs of wear and wear and tear.
